摘要
Designing for augmented reality (AR) applications is difficult and expensive. A rapid system for the early design process of spatial interfaces is required. Previous research has used video for mobile AR design, but this is not extensible to head-mounted AR. AR is an emergent technology with no prior design precedent, requiring designers to allow free speculation or risk the pitfalls of “path dependence.” In this ar ticle, a par ticipatory elicitation method we call “spatial informance design” is presented. We found combining “informance design,” “Wizard of Oz,” improvisation, and “paper proto-typing,” to be a fast and lightweight solution for ideation of rich designs for spatial interfaces. A study using our method with 11 par ticipants, produced similar and wildly different interface configurations and interactions for an augmented reality email application. Based on our findings, we propose design implications and an evaluation of oumethod using spatial informance for the design of head-mounted AR applications. © 2022 by the Massachusetts Institute of Technology.
